    The caprese was delicious with the salted heirloom tomato's. This was my favorite out of the three dishes that we tried. The risotto itself was a little bland and lacked any flavor, the shrimp and scallops were seasoned with a Cajun salty spice but it truly should have been all over because the dish was very bland. The rigatoni vodka was delicious and the pasta was the perfect texture. Random tip- bring a smaller purse because there is nowhere to set it unless you're at a table with a bench. Overall I really loved the decor and ambiance and definitely want to come back to try some other dishes on the menu! Service was wonderful and I like the red bow ties everyone was wearing.

    Post-theater dinner at a new restaurant. Our friends suggested Amore Mio because they've dined here before. Now I see why. The staff was so friendly and on top of everything, especially our server Dennae. She provided great service and was engaging. The food was delicious. The four of us shared a bottle of wine and the focaccia with ricotta and prosciutto. Next my husband had the tomato basil soup, and I had the grilled romaine. I tasted the tomato soup and it was luxurious and creamy, and I don't even like tomato soup. The grilled romaine had a good char, but I would've preferred a dressing like a Caesar. For the main event, my husband had chicken parmesan and I had the whitefish. Both of our entrees were delicious. I think the chicken Parmesan, though, was the better of the two. I usually don't order chicken Parmesan because it's deep fried and my husband's chicken was light and moist and seem like it was baked so a healthier version. My whitefish was full of flavor with a lemon caper sauce and was perfectly moist I was worried seeing the 3.5 rating on Yelp. I think Amore Mio deserves a better rating. We'll definitely be making a return visit. Not only because we enjoyed the eats, but the location was within walking distance of the Paramount Theater. A great pre- or post-theater place to dine. FYI they also have a cocktail lounge on the basement with piano music and live entertainment.
